Soil stabilization using the fly ash - international experience and initial results of own research

This paper presents the most imporant results of published international researches about soil stabilization using fly ash. The reaction mechanism of fly ash on important physical and mechanical properties of soil is described. Also, the own laboratory testing results of improving the soil from the borrow pits at the site of the future regional waste management center “Kalenić” in village Kalenić, by adding the fly ash from thermal power plant “Kolubara” are presented.
